Updated August 11, 2006

2005: Played in 20 matches and 59 games used primarily in the defensive specialist role • averaged 1.42 digs per game • recorded a season-high 18 digs and tied a career-best four block assists against Missouri State (11/5).

2004: Played in 27 matches, starting 12 • appeared in 84 games for the Salukis • finished the season second on the team in digs per game (2.55) and third in digs (214) • posted two double-doubles, including 10 kills, 19 digs against Eastern Illinois (9/10), recording a career-high in digs • hit a career-best .625 at Drake Oct. 1 (11 kills, 1 error, 16 attempts) • finished the season hitting .171 with 119 kills, 11 assists and seven blocks.

2003: Started 18 and played in 28 matches, including 83 games • posted a career-high 23 kills vs. Charlotte (9/6) and added 14 digs for a double-double • finished second in digs per game (2.52), third in attempts (574) and fourth in digs (209) and kills per game (2.23) • finished with seven double-doubles • recorded a season-best 17 digs vs. Buffalo (9/5) and Iowa (8/30) • had a career-high two solo and four total blocks vs. Indiana State (11/7).

Brookfield Central High School: Named fifth team all-state and first team all-conference as a senior • a four-year letterwinner in volleyball • earned first team all-conference honors as a junior.

Personal: Full name is Ashley Lyn Saverine • Majoring in finance • Born on September 5, 1984 in Brookfield, Wis. • Has two brothers, Ryan and Tony • Played club volleyball for the Milwaukee Sting with teammate Holly Marita, where her team was the national runner-up at the 2002 USA Volleyball 17-under open division • Daughter of Lyn Peterson and Ralph Saverine
